Q: Is 12,700,140 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 12,700,140 is a composite number.

Why is 12,700,140 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 12,700,140 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 10 12 15 20 23 30 46 60 69 92 115 138 230 276 345 460 690 1,380 9,203 18,406 27,609 36,812 46,015 55,218 92,030 110,436 138,045 184,060 211,669 276,090 423,338 552,180 635,007 846,676 1,058,345 1,270,014 2,116,690 2,540,028 3,175,035 4,233,380 6,350,070 and 12,700,140, with no remainder.

Since 12,700,140 cannot be divided by just 1 and 12,700,140, it is a composite number.
